I have a strange issue. My SeaMonkey v2.33's e-mail composer keeps
sending in plain text format when I am sending a HTML formatted e-mail
to an address not listed in the Preferences' list and addressbooks. Am I
missing something? Or did I run into a bug?

What do you have in Edit > Preferences > Mail & Newsgroups > Send
Format? It sounds like that may be set to "Convert the message to plain
text". Or perhaps some of the domains you're sending to are listed under
"plain text domains".

"Ask me what to do (Mail prompts you to choose a format)" and no domains listed in both lists.


You probably want either "Ask me what to do" (you'll get prompted every
time you send an HTML message) or "Send the message in both plain text
and HTML" (so anyone reading as plain text get a reasonably readable
version).

If I have it in HTML format, then shouldn't it just send in HTML format due to no domains. However, it never asks me what to do. Note these are NEW e-mails sent to e-mail addressess not listed in my addressbooks and domain lists.
